黑狐家游戏

海量登录日志如何排序和处理,高效海量登录日志分析与处理策略

欧气 0 0

本文目录导读:

海量登录日志如何排序和处理,高效海量登录日志分析与处理策略

图片来源于网络,如有侵权联系删除

  1. 数据采集与预处理
  2. 海量登录日志排序
  3. 海量登录日志处理

随着互联网的快速发展,各类应用系统、平台以及企业都在不断积累海量登录日志,如何对这些海量登录日志进行高效排序和处理,成为企业信息化建设中的关键问题,本文将从以下几个方面探讨如何根据海量登录日志进行排序和处理,以减少相同内容出现,提高日志分析效率。

数据采集与预处理

1、数据采集

需要明确登录日志的数据来源,如服务器、数据库、缓存等,通过数据采集工具,如Flume、Logstash等,将登录日志实时传输到数据仓库。

2、数据预处理

(1)数据清洗:对采集到的登录日志进行清洗,去除无效、重复的数据,如空日志、异常字符等。

(2)数据转换:将原始的登录日志格式转换为统一格式,如JSON、CSV等,方便后续处理。

(3)数据去重:通过设置唯一标识(如用户ID、IP地址等),去除重复的登录日志。

海量登录日志排序

1、时间排序

根据登录日志的时间戳进行排序,以便于后续分析用户行为、登录高峰期等。

2、用户排序

按照用户ID或昵称进行排序,便于分析用户登录情况、活跃度等。

海量登录日志如何排序和处理,高效海量登录日志分析与处理策略

图片来源于网络,如有侵权联系删除

3、IP地址排序

按照IP地址进行排序,便于分析地域分布、异常登录等。

4、设备类型排序

根据登录日志中的设备信息,如操作系统、浏览器等,对登录日志进行排序,以便于分析不同设备的使用情况。

海量登录日志处理

1、数据挖掘

(1)用户行为分析:通过分析登录日志,了解用户登录频率、登录时间、登录地点等,为精准营销、个性化推荐等提供数据支持。

(2)异常登录检测:通过分析登录日志,识别异常登录行为,如频繁尝试密码、异地登录等,提高系统安全性。

(3)登录高峰期预测:通过分析登录日志,预测未来一段时间内的登录高峰期,为系统优化、资源分配等提供依据。

2、数据可视化

利用图表、报表等形式,将登录日志数据直观地展示出来,便于分析和决策。

3、数据存储与备份

海量登录日志如何排序和处理,高效海量登录日志分析与处理策略

图片来源于网络,如有侵权联系删除

(1)数据存储:将处理后的登录日志数据存储在分布式文件系统(如HDFS)或数据库中,便于后续查询和分析。

(2)数据备份:定期对登录日志数据进行备份,防止数据丢失。

1、优化策略

(1)并行处理:利用分布式计算框架(如Spark、Flink等)对海量登录日志进行并行处理,提高处理效率。

(2)内存优化:在处理过程中,合理分配内存资源,避免内存溢出。

(3)算法优化:针对具体业务需求,优化算法,提高处理效果。

2、总结

通过对海量登录日志进行排序和处理,可以有效减少相同内容出现,提高日志分析效率,在实际应用中,还需结合业务需求,不断优化策略,为企业和用户提供更优质的服务。

标签: #海量日志分析解决方案

黑狐家游戏
  • 评论列表

留言评论